The International Transportation Economics Association (ITEA) invites papers in transportation economics for our conference (my favorite) in Bergamo, Italy. There is also a wonderful 2-day school.
February 28 – extended abstracts due
June 15-19 - Conference+school

Last week a judge allowed a lawsuit to proceed which seeks to reinstate the plan to charge vehicles traveling through parts of Manhattan after Gov. Kathy Hochul halted the plans in June. It’s been a long road to get a congestion charge in NYC with some plans dating back 70 years
